Alam El Shawish West Oil and Gas Concession is an operating oil and gas concession in Egypt.

Project Details

Main Data

Table 1: Concession-level project details for Alam El Shawish West Oil and Gas Concession

1Final Investment Decision
2If a country or region is known to not produce any hydrocarbons in an unconventional method, this production type is assumed to be conventional
Unit name Status Operator Owner Discovery year FID1 year Production start year Production type2
Alam El Shawish West Operating[1][2] Cheiron[3] Neptune Energy (25.0%); Cheiron (20.0%); North Petroleum International Company S.A (35.0%); Capricorn Energy (20.0%)[3] 2010[1] Conventional

Production and Reserves

Table 2: Reserves of Alam El Shawish West Oil and Gas Concession

million m³ = million cubic meters
million bbl = million barrels of oil
million boe = million barrels of oil equivalent
Fuel description Reserves classification Quantity Units Data year Source
crude oil and condensate Remaining recoverable reserves 3.64 million bbl 2021 [1]
gas Remaining recoverable reserves 6484.78 million m³ 2021 [1]
hydrocarbons 2P reserves 66 million boe 2023 [3]

Table 3: Production from Alam El Shawish West Oil and Gas Concession

million m³/y = million cubic meters per year
million bbl/y = million barrels of oil per year
Category Fuel description Quantity Units Data year Source
production crude oil and condensate 10.21 million bbl/y 2015 [1]
production gas 857.85 million m³/y 2015 [1]
